Living Water Primary School in Belameling Camp in Palorinya District opened in January with 200 preschool children and 200 primary students, grade levels one through three. This is the first school experience for the majority of these pupils. We are in the process of constructing another building for grade levels four through seven, scheduled to open in January 2023.
First and foremost, Living Water Primary is dedicated to training up disciples of Christ. The curriculum being used in our primary school is called “Rafiki” (means “friend in Swahili). The teachers have been trained in this Biblically based method. The teachers are refugees from the same local community.
God, through His people, has provided the buildings, teachers, food, uniforms, backpacks, and curriculum. Shoes for the pupils are on their way. And a new borehole will soon be drilled to provide clean drinking water on the compound. I am humbled and amazed at His provision.
